    About One Valley Foundation

    The One Valley Foundation is committed to ensuring an inclusive community for our fans, united through a shared passion for sports. We aim to create greater opportunity and impact across the Coachella Valley through programs and legacy events focused on Community, Education, and Access to Hockey, with nearly every dollar raised remaining in the Coachella Valley to serve all nine cities.

    About One Valley Foundation

    A $333,333 restoration grant to the Palm Springs Plaza Theatre Foundation stands out in One Valley Foundation’s recent giving and points to a pattern of large, place-based support. The foundation pairs that kind of legacy investment with grants for cancer patient transportation, military support, youth hockey access, Pride programming, food relief, animal shelter care, and scholarships for female students. Its work is tightly tied to the Coachella Valley, with almost all recent grants staying in California and the foundation describing a community-focused approach across Community, Education, and Access to Hockey. The grant record also shows repeated support for local organizations serving specific needs: Desert Cancer Foundation received funding for cancer patient support, while Greater Palm Springs Pride was funded for fundraiser sponsorship. Other awards reach into youth and school settings through school district and booster-group grants, and into direct service through organizations such as Food Now and the Palm Springs USO. Leadership is listed as Grant Fuhr, and the foundation operates as a regular funder rather than a donor-advised fund.

    What One Valley Foundation Funds

    Education is a defined pillar in the foundation’s grantmaking. In 2025, it gave $20,000 to Coachella Valley Unified School District for Future Farmers of America youth programs, and it also funded classroom and school-based work through its Education Grants and Classroom Grants Program. Access to hockey is another consistent theme. One Valley Foundation awarded $15,640 to Coachella Valley Hockey Foundation Corp for youth hockey equipment, and it also runs grants that cover registration, gear, and other barriers to participation for Coachella Valley youth. Community support appears in direct-service grants as well: Family Services of the Desert dba Food Now received $11,000 for food bank support. The foundation also funded inclusive programming, including $21,285 to Palm Springs Pride for youth programming and Pride support.

    How One Valley Foundation Gives

    Typical grants cluster at a modest local scale: the p25 is $15,320, the median is $20,000, and the p75 is $34,000. The distribution includes a few much larger awards, especially the two $333,333 grants to the same theatre foundation across 2024 and 2025, alongside smaller program and sponsorship grants. The recent record shows repeat support to some recipients across multiple years, including that theatre foundation and the Grant Fuhr Foundation. One Valley Foundation is classified as a regular funder, not a DAF, and it does not fund individuals or make program-related investments. Some grant programs accept unsolicited requests, including Youth Hockey Grants and certain Community Grants programs.

    Where One Valley Foundation Makes Grants

    Grantmaking is highly concentrated in the Coachella Valley, with 95% of grants going to recipients in California. The recent list shows awards landing in Palm Springs, Palm Desert, Rancho Mirage, Indio, Thermal, Desert Hot Springs, Thousand Palms, Loma Linda, Sacramento, and Arlington, VA. California dominates the map, while Virginia appears through USO-related support in Arlington.     Frequently Asked Questions About One Valley Foundation

    What are One Valley Foundation’s main focus areas?

    The foundation’s stated pillars are Community, Education, and Access to Hockey. Recent grants also show support for cancer patient transportation, military and USO services, youth development, food security, animal shelter medical care, and scholarships for female students.

    What is the typical grant size?

    The grant-size distribution is centered at $20,000. The 25th percentile is $15,320 and the 75th percentile is $34,000, which places most awards in a relatively narrow local funding band, with a few much larger outliers.

    Does One Valley Foundation fund organizations outside California?

    Its giving is local and 95% of grants go to recipients in California. The recent grant list includes one recipient in Arlington, Virginia, through USO-related support, but the rest of the listed grants are in California.

    Does One Valley Foundation accept unsolicited applications?

    Some of its active programs do accept unsolicited requests, including Youth Hockey Grants and certain Community Grants pathways. Other programs, such as Education Grants and Classroom Grants, are listed as not accepting unsolicited applications.

    Do recent grants show repeat support to the same organizations?

    Yes. The Palm Springs Plaza Theatre Foundation received $333,333 in both 2024 and 2025, and the Grant Fuhr Foundation received $20,000 in 2024 and $20,000 in 2025. That suggests at least some multi-year relationships in the recent record.

    Open Grant Opportunities

    Current and upcoming funding from One Valley Foundation that your nonprofit may be able to apply for.

    Open nowCloses Sep 30, 2026

    Foundation Grants

    Elementary Literacy & Student EngagementMiddle School Leadership DevelopmentHigh School Workforce Pathways+11 more

    Who can apply: Applicants must be IRS-recognized tax-exempt 501(c)(3) nonprofit organizations in good standing, provide programs or services that directly benefit the Coachella Valley, submit a request aligned with at least one approved pillar and focus area, demonstrate clear community need and intended local impact, and agree to provide a post-program or post-grant impact report. One Valley Foundation does not accept applications directly from individual schools or school districts; school-based programs must be submitted and administered by an eligible nonprofit organization.

    Deadline: Summer Cycle: August 1 – September 30 (awarded in December); Winter Cycle: January 1 – February 28 (awarded in May).
